diff --git a/.gitignore b/.gitignore index ea3bb573..d991fc96 100644 --- a/.gitignore +++ b/.gitignore @@ -4,7 +4,6 @@ admin/archive.php admin/assign_owner.php admin/delete_tickets.php admin/generate_spam_question.php -admin/lock.php admin/move_category.php admin/options.php admin/priority.php diff --git a/admin/lock.php b/admin/lock.php new file mode 100644 index 00000000..04a2b8c6 --- /dev/null +++ b/admin/lock.php @@ -0,0 +1,82 @@ +fetch_assoc(); +$statusId = $statusRow['ID']; + +hesk_dbQuery("UPDATE `".hesk_dbEscape($hesk_settings['db_pfix'])."tickets` SET `status`='{$statusId}',`locked`='{$status}', `history`=CONCAT(`history`,'".hesk_dbEscape($revision)."') WHERE `trackid`='".hesk_dbEscape($trackingID)."' LIMIT 1"); + +/* Back to ticket page and show a success message */ +hesk_process_messages($tmp,'admin_ticket.php?track='.$trackingID.'&Refresh='.rand(10000,99999),'SUCCESS'); +?>